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
Документирование базы в MS SQL7
|
|||
|---|---|---|---|
|
#18+
Существует ли возможность документирования базы непосредственно в MS SQL7? Имеется в виду краткие комментарии к таблицам, полям таблиц, хранимым процедурам. Что-то вроде: Contractors - список контрагентов Contractors.ID - ключевое поле Contractors.NickName - краткое название контрагента usp_OneContractor - выборка одного контрагента из списка параметры: @ID - код записи Понятно, что можно придумать "говорящие" имена. Выработать некоторые "стнадарты" для своей базы данных. В хранимых процедурах написать кучу коментариев. Но все это не очень-то удобно. Все сводится к тому, что необходимо где-то отдельно (вообще в другой системе) вести подробную документацию на свою базу данных. Неужели нет никаких встроенных средств в MS SQL7 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 27.03.2002, 08:18 |
|
||
|
Документирование базы в MS SQL7
|
|||
|---|---|---|---|
|
#18+
Такого "умного" документатора не видно.Ты же профессионал Фокса Создай в своей БД пару таблиц (например my_objects my_objects_comments), связанных по ключу и заполняй их по мере создания объектов. Я так попробовал- вроде ниче получается (все рядом лежит)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 27.03.2002, 16:43 |
|
||
|
Документирование базы в MS SQL7
|
|||
|---|---|---|---|
|
#18+
Конечно, это можно сделать. Но не вижу смысла. Проще уж в Word-e или Excel-e писать документацию. Я то надеялся, что в MS SQL как в проекте FoxPro есть место для краткого комментария, чтобы двигаясь, например, по полям таблицы в статус-строке видеть краткое описание этого поля. Жаль, что такого нет 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2002, 09:37 |
|
||
|
Документирование базы в MS SQL7
|
|||
|---|---|---|---|
|
#18+
Ну почему же, в SQL2K все это возможно благодаря extended properties. Или тебе этого мало? Естественно, примечания о назначении колонок и таблиц нужно писать самостоятельно. Не думаю, что какой-нибудь Fox (включая Малдера и Агента007) может сам догадаться о назначении определенных столбцов только по их взаимному геометрическому расположению.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2002, 11:11 |
|
||
|
Документирование базы в MS SQL7
|
|||
|---|---|---|---|
|
#18+
Это, конечно, хорошо. Но у меня MS SQL 7.0 Соотвественно, в списке параметров ColumnProperty() я как-то не обнаружил чего-нибудь вроде "Comment". Или я не там искал?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2002, 11:32 |
|
||
|
Документирование базы в MS SQL7
|
|||
|---|---|---|---|
|
#18+
А почему бы не использовать ErWin или что-то подобное. Всегда будет под рукой логическая модель БД, где все можно по-русски расписать. Да и точная копия структуры БД будет. А база может и угробиться. К тому же у ErWin`а масса других полезных свойств.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.03.2002, 15:26 |
|
||
|
Документирование базы в MS SQL7
|
|||
|---|---|---|---|
|
#18+
К тому же в последствии схему ErWin'а можно экспортировать в какой тебе будет угодно формат .. и Word и Excel и PDF и тд.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.03.2002, 08:55 |
|
||
|
Документирование базы в MS SQL7
|
|||
|---|---|---|---|
|
#18+
К сожалению, у меня и ErWin нету и $5000 (чтобы его купить) тоже нету А у пиратов найти весьма проблематично - не самый продоваемый продукт. Да и если база накроется восстановление ее структуры это будет не самый главный вопрос Кстати, по ErWin - при модификации структуры базы в момент сброса в MS SQL произойдет затирание уже существующей базы или только необходимая корректировка? Как вообще в этом случае отслеживать модификацию структуры?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.03.2002, 10:07 |
|
||
|
Документирование базы в MS SQL7
|
|||
|---|---|---|---|
|
#18+
Произойдет только необходимая корректировка. ErWin вообще самый лучший в этом плане (structure merge) продукт из тех, что я видел. BTW, если кто-нибудь работал на ErWin4 с SQL 2000, не поделитесь информацией - он нормально текст хранимых процедур распознает? А то я попробовал работать с ним и вынужден был откатиться на версию 3.5.2, т.к. он код хранимых процедур добивал пробелами...Заранее благодарен.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.03.2002, 10:37 |
|
||
|
Документирование базы в MS SQL7
|
|||
|---|---|---|---|
|
#18+
А зачем покупать ЕрВин? На interface.ru есть триальная версия, а ключик к ней всегда найти можно. Да и не только с interface.ru скачать можно.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 29.03.2002, 15:10 |
|
||
|
|

start [/forum/topic.php?fid=46&msg=32027007&tid=1823229]: |
0ms |
get settings: |
8ms |
get forum list: |
20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
147ms |
get topic data: |
11ms |
get forum data: |
3ms |
get page messages: |
65ms |
get tp. blocked users: |
1ms |
| others: | 236ms |
| total: | 499ms |

| 0 / 0 |
